Description

A critical vulnerability exists in Oracle Hyperion Financial Management version 11.2.26.0.000 that allows a highly privileged attacker with network access via Oracle Net to fully compromise the product. The vulnerability impacts confidentiality, integrity, and availability, potentially leading to complete takeover of the affected system. This vulnerability is part of Oracle's September 2026 Critical Security Patch Update, which addresses numerous security issues across Oracle products.

Technical Analysis

CVE-2026-87189 is a critical security vulnerability in Oracle Hyperion Financial Management (component: Security) version 11.2.26.0.000. It allows a high privileged attacker with network access via Oracle Net to compromise the product, resulting in complete takeover. The CVSS 3.1 base score is 9.1, reflecting high impact on confidentiality, integrity, and availability. The vulnerability may also affect additional Oracle products due to scope change. This issue is addressed in Oracle's September 2026 Critical Security Patch Update.

Potential Impact

Successful exploitation can lead to full compromise of Oracle Hyperion Financial Management, impacting confidentiality, integrity, and availability of the system. The vulnerability requires high privileges and network access via Oracle Net. The scope of impact may extend to other Oracle products.

Mitigation Recommendations

Oracle has released a Critical Security Patch Update in September 2026 that addresses this vulnerability. Customers are strongly advised to apply the relevant security patches promptly. Oracle recommends remaining on actively supported versions and applying security patches without delay to mitigate this and other vulnerabilities.
